The Malta Song for Europe 2008 shows were initially scheduled for February 21 (semifinal) and February 23rd (final). Now, and due to the General elections that will be held in the Mediterranean state, the Malta Song Board has decided to bring the show forward to January 24 (semi) and January 26 (final).

Therefore, the rest of the dates also suffer changes: the second live phase will be televised between January 9 and 12 January, when the 36 participating songs will be narrowed down to 16.

Aspokesman of the Malta Song Board stated to our partner site escmalta.com that those dates are "more then likely to be the final new dates", although there is no official confirmation yet. It is expected that this confirmation will arrive at the end of this week or at the beginning of the next one. Some details about the venue could be revealed as well.
